Transaction 6f15df59868ae31baee356041d56ac2dd34840f89dcc55fdab97c8e4dda5b26a
1 Input
1 Output
-
6f15df59868ae31baee356041d56ac2dd34840f89dcc55fdab97c8e4dda5b26a: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ee10230e2b9f2f9b9220794af4babb449ee212fab83c47d518ab16ef4cd93585
- address
- bc1pacgzxr3tnuhehy3q0990fw4mgj0wyyh6hq7y04gc4vtw7nxexkzs65fc9j